It touches on the danger of uncontrolled population growth, something that most environmental organizations do not want to discuss. The opinions that rich capitalists have taken over the environmental movement, and that environmental leaders like Bill McKibben and the Sierra Club have sold out is put forward. There is some effective use of TV interviews and stock footage, but overall this paints a bleak picture and offers very little in the way of solutions. Expand
